    Engine mount on mbe4000 that's on the passenger side, on the flywheel housing, all the bolts snapped. The shop that is doing the work has my truck for over a week now i think they are lying to me for some reason or another... Does the transmission has to come off, and how many hours of labor am i looking at?

    Trans probably has to come out. If it is the flywheel housing not the bell housing probably 15 to 20 hours. Removing broken bolts often runs into extra extra time. Are they housing and brackets still good?
